Childhood Obesity

• A condition where a child ages 2-17 have to much body fat that negatively affects the child’s health or wellbeing.

• Childhood obesity has more than

tripled in the past 30 years

• The prevalence of obesity was higher for boys then girls in a

study done in 2009-2010.

Socioeconomic & Culture

• Research suggests that Caucasian children are at a reduced risk for obesity compared to African American /Hispanics.

• This has a lot to do with socioeconomic standing

• Culture to culture different foods are considered “healthy”
